Following the board's request, we reviewed the proposed 18% cut to the Aldervane Group marketing budget for the coming fiscal year. Savings of approximately 2.1 million are achievable, concentrated in trade events and print placements, with digital spend largely protected. Modelling suggests a lead-generation decline of 7–9% in the second half, partially offset by the Quillbrook referral programme. We recommend phasing the reduction across two quarters to limit disruption. The board's confidential direction is recorded below.

management briefing: Project Ulavan slips by two quarters because of the staffing delay.

### Onboarding: the `tailor` log-tailing CLI

As a code reviewer at Marrowlight, you'll see frequent changes to `tailor`, our internal CLI for streaming service logs. Review points: the filter grammar is versioned, so grammar changes need a compatibility shim; and any change to the transport layer must preserve ordered delivery per stream. Releases are built by the `tailor-release` job, which signs each binary so hosts can verify provenance before install. Verification uses the signing key recorded below.

rollout seal: bky4_x7Gc

// TIMETABLE_MAX_SWAP_DEPTH
//
// Caps how many room-swap chains the Glimmerplan solver will
// explore per iteration. Raising this past 6 blew up runtime on
// the Norwick Academy dataset without improving conflict counts,
// per the benchmarks shared at last week's sync. Keep at 4 until
// the incremental scorer lands. Any change must rerun the full
// suite; the resulting build token appears directly below.

trace token, hahof-bafop: htk3_b54

### Step 4: Resolve calendar sync conflict

Before cutting the Ashgrove release, pause the Tilbridge calendar sync or the deploy window will double-book against maintenance holds. Run `calsync pause --env prod`, confirm the lock, then proceed. The pause command authenticates via the sync credential, which must appear on the following line.

vault entry, yahif-yajep: COURIER_KEY29=b802bdf8034096b65a51c6ba5abe2